Directiоns: When а signаling mоlecule cаlled epinephrine binds tо an alpha-1 receptor, a signaling pathway results in phospholipase C (PLC) activation which cleaves PIP2 from the membrane into IP3 and DAG. IP3 binds to receptors on the Endoplasmic Reticulum to cause calcium release. This calcium binds to calmodulin which is transported into the nucleus and binds to Calmodulin-dependent kinase IV (CAMKIV) which phosphorylated CREB to activate gene transcription. The DAG from PLC activates protein kinase C (PKC) which phosphorylates Glycogen synthase, inactivating it. Phosphate groups are yellow circles.
